Output 56cda85c3cab735605a92847f902304084e1f68179246931f7b2c481380fab6e:3

value
44077927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 533139e53d97bf80d55bc2eb110463a2553d1bbc OP_EQUAL
address
MFV3HeNw3zueqaD2mnrvZ9eAeAPpZAkwHb
transaction
56cda85c3cab735605a92847f902304084e1f68179246931f7b2c481380fab6e
spent
true